A Cross-site scripting (XSS) vulnerability was discovered on Intelbras Win 240 V1.1.0 devices. An attacker can change the Admin Password without a Login.

A stored cross-site scripting (XSS) vulnerability in the Intelbras Win 240 V1.1.0 wireless router allows unauthenticated attackers to inject malicious scripts that execute in the context of the administrator's session, enabling unauthorized admin password changes without any prior authentication.

MitigationRestrict physical and network access to the device's management interface; implement network segmentation; contact Intelbras for firmware updates; monitor for unauthorized configuration changes.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.

dbcve checks

Work through these to decide whether this CVE applies to you.

  1. Identify the device model
    Locate the router label or access the web management interface to confirm the model is Intelbras Win 240
    Affected if The device is not an Intelbras Win 240 router
  2. Check the firmware version
    Access the router web interface (typically at 192.168.1.1) and navigate to the firmware or status page to view the installed version, or use command-line tools like 'telnet' or 'curl' to query the device's version endpoint
    Affected if The firmware version is exactly 1.1.0
  3. Verify web management interface accessibility
    Confirm the router's HTTP/HTTPS management interface is reachable from the network by attempting to access the device's IP address in a browser or via curl
    Affected if The web interface is exposed to the network (this is required for the XSS vector)
  4. Inspect for unauthorized admin password changes
    Log into the router admin panel and check the admin account settings for any unexpected password modifications, or review system logs for password change events
    Affected if The admin password was changed without the legitimate administrator's knowledge

The device is affected if it is an Intelbras Win 240 router running firmware version 1.1.0 and its web management interface is network-accessible, allowing the stored XSS to execute in an administrator's session.
